Barclays analyst Brendan Lynch raised the firm’s price target on First Industrial Realty to $56 from $52 and keeps an Equal Weight rating on the shares as part of a Q3 earnings preview for the real estate investment trust and communications infrastructure group. The firm expects continued leasing momentum in Sunbelt markets and sees an improving leasing environment across Manhattan.
